Output 2620631c82986dde04f25b1f7cb91583c99491e634e05e9cfb431c202811d932:0

value
977846041
script pubkey
OP_0 OP_PUSHBYTES_20 1b2f0b8b157f305906b7345ff44e168ff36e9706
address
ltc1qrvhshzc40uc9jp4hx30lgnsk3leka9cx4uw5c5
transaction
2620631c82986dde04f25b1f7cb91583c99491e634e05e9cfb431c202811d932
spent
true